#1dd9d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dd9d7 is composed of 11.4% red, 85.1%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 179.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 48.2%. #1dd9d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00b3af.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1dd9d7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1dd9d7 has RGB values of R:29, G:217,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1956311.

Shades and Tints of #1dd9d7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010909 is the darkest color, while #f7f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1dd9d7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#728484 is the less saturated color, while #01f5f3 is the most saturated one.
